βΏ How To Reduce Waste While Traveling In Petra?
As you wander through the breathtaking canyons and ancient facades of Petra, the rose-red city carved from sandstone, consider how your travel choices can honor this UNESCO World Heritage Site and its delicate ecosystem. Embrace the local culture by opting for reusable water bottles, which not only reduce plastic waste but also connect you with the community β many local vendors offer refills, allowing you to savor the refreshing taste of clean water amidst the arid landscape. Engage with the flavors of traditional Jordanian cuisine by dining at local eateries, where meals are often served on biodegradable materials, minimizing your environmental footprint. As you traverse the narrow Siq, listen to the whispers of the wind and the soft crunch of gravel underfoot, reminding you to tread lightly and leave no trace behind. Respect the ancient ruins by refraining from touching the carvings and structures, preserving their integrity for future generations. By being mindful of your impact, you can fully immerse yourself in the timeless beauty of Petra, forging a deeper connection with both the land and its vibrant, resilient culture.
π‘ Petra 2 Day Tour
Embarking on a two-day tour of Petra is akin to stepping into a living tapestry of ancient history and sublime nature, where the whispers of the past harmonize with the rustling leaves of the surrounding cliffs. As the sun rises over the Rose City, the soft hues of pink and red sandstone glow warmly, inviting you to explore its intricate facades carved by the Nabataeans over 2,000 years ago. On the first day, meander through the Siq, a narrow gorge that opens dramatically to reveal the majestic Treasury, its ornate details bathed in golden light. Pause to absorb the echo of history while savoring the scent of wild thyme and sage that blankets the air. On your second day, venture further to the Monastery, a less-trodden path that rewards the intrepid with breathtaking views of the surrounding landscape. Engage with local Bedouins who share their stories, reminding us of our shared humanity and the importance of sustainable travel. As you leave, the spirit of Petra lingers, a gentle reminder of the resilience of nature and the enduring beauty of cultural heritage.

Faqs β Common Questions, Gentle Answers
Do I need travel insurance for international trips?
Yes. Travel insurance can cover medical emergencies, lost luggage, trip cancellations, and other unexpected events.
How do I deal with language barriers?
Learn a few key phrases, use translation apps, or carry a pocket dictionary. Gestures and patience also help.
Is it safe to eat street food?
Yes, if itβs freshly cooked and served hot. Look for stalls with many locals, which often indicates good quality.
